Consumer Protection Laws Applicable to Payday Loans

Several consumer protection laws in Oklahoma are designed to mitigate the risks associated with payday loans. These laws aim to ensure transparency and fair treatment for borrowers.

  • Truth in Lending Act (TILA): This federal law requires lenders to disclose all loan terms and costs clearly to borrowers. This includes the APR, fees, and repayment schedule. Understanding these disclosures is vital for making an informed borrowing decision.
  • Oklahoma Consumer Credit Code: This state law provides additional protections for consumers, including restrictions on certain lending practices and requirements for clear and concise disclosures.
  •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A): This federal law protects consumers from abusive, deceptive, and unfair debt collection practices. It sets limits on how debt collectors can contact borrowers and what actions they can take.

Credit Unions as an Alternative to Payday Loans, Payday loans shawnee ok

Credit unions are member-owned financial institutions that often offer more favorable loan terms than traditional banks or payday lenders. They prioritize community well-being and frequently provide small loans with lower interest rates and flexible repayment options. Eligibility criteria typically involve membership (often tied to employment or geographic location), a checking account, and a verifiable income. The application process usually involves completing an application form, providing proof of income and identification, and potentially undergoing a credit check. Some credit unions offer small loans specifically designed to help members avoid the high-cost trap of payday loans. These loans may have shorter repayment periods than traditional loans but significantly lower interest rates compared to payday loans.

Tips for Budgeting and Saving Money

Developing a budget and saving consistently are essential steps to avoid relying on payday loans. These tips are tailored for individuals in Shawnee, OK, considering payday loans as a solution to immediate financial needs.

  • Track your spending: For at least a month, meticulously record every expense, no matter how small. This will give you a clear picture of where your money is going. Utilize budgeting apps or spreadsheets to simplify this process.
  • Create a realistic budget: Allocate funds for essential expenses (housing, food, transportation, utilities), followed by non-essential expenses (entertainment, dining out). Prioritize essential expenses and aim to reduce non-essential spending where possible. Consider the 50/30/20 rule: 50% needs, 30% wants, 20% savings and debt repayment.
  • Identify areas to cut back: Analyze your spending to find areas where you can reduce expenses without significantly impacting your quality of life. This could involve reducing dining out, canceling unused subscriptions, or finding cheaper alternatives for everyday goods.
  • Set savings goals: Establish short-term and long-term savings goals. Start small, even with a few dollars a week. Automate savings by setting up automatic transfers from your checking to your savings account.
  • Explore additional income streams: Consider part-time work, freelancing, or selling unused items to supplement your income. Even a small increase in income can make a significant difference in your ability to manage expenses and build savings.
